WebJun 17, 2024 · These timber panels, which can measure up to 3.5m in width and 20m in length, depending on specification, can be used to create the complete superstructure of a building. CLT panels are precision cut by CNC machines (from 3D CAD drawings) and delivered to site to be installed by specialist CLT installers. WebJun 5, 2024 · Attendance at this course is mandatory for trainees between months 9 and 24 of their traineeship. The course has been designed to be entirely interactive, with trainees encouraged to reflect upon practice and consider how ethics assimilates with their … WebEdinburgh Law School is accredited by the Law Society of Scotland to provide mandatory ethics to trainees. The mandatory ethics course takes 4 hours and is taught by way of presentation, exercises and group … WebMay 30, 2024 · Overview.
